Robert Gene 'Bob' age 51 of Edmond passed away July 8, 2005. Bob was born May 24, 1954 to Eugene and Isabel Knobbe in Melrose Park, IL. A long-time area businessman he and his wife owned and operated Pasta Pizzaz, a wholesale pasta business supplying many area and statewide restaurants. Bob was...
